Brief summary

The goal of this \[type of study: exercise intervention study\] is to test in describe participant health conditions. The main questions it aims to answer are: * \[Whether physical exercise improves executive function of male heroin addicts\] * \[Whether physical exercise improves negative thinking/affect psychological experience of male heroin addicts\] Participants will be randomly selected for medium-intensity strength training (resistance exercise,n=30), 30 will be selected for 1-hour long balloon volleyball sessions (aerobic exercise) at 60-70% volume of oxygen uptake during peak exercise, weekly 5 times for 12 weeks; and 30 will be assigned to the no-exercise control group, Participants will perform Executive function tests and the Symptom Checklist-90 Revised questionnaire at pre and post intervention. Researchers will compare resistance exercise group,aerobic exercise group and no-exercise control group to see if effects of exercise on executive function and negative thinking/affect psychological experience of male heroin addicts.

Interventions

BEHAVIORALAerobic exercise; Resistance exercise

To investigate affect/effect of dissimilar modes of exercise, Aerobic exercise versus Resistance exercise, on execution function and psychological symptoms in heroin addicts, 1 hour of characteristic exercise protocols aiming to (a) maximize the strain on the cardiovascular system with Aerobic exercise(60-70% of heart rate recovery) and (b) promote the greatest hypertrophy response with Resistance exercise(65% of 1 repetition maximum & repeated up to 15 time) were used. Both exercise programs were designed to match the male heroin addicts, with medium-intensity Strength-Trained for Resistance exercise and playing balloon volleyball for Aerobic exercise. Two exercise groups performed at 65% of their pre-determine peak oxygen uptake.
